It took some emojis until the demand for multi-colored fonts was big enough to develop additional tables to store this information within OpenType fonts. Multiplying does not sound like an elegant solution and it is a constant source of errors. ![]() Analog to letterpress the content needs to be doubled and superimposed to have more than one color per glyph. There can be several outlines in a glyph but when the font is used to set type the assigned color applies to all outlines. Simulation of two overprinting colors resulting in a third.ĭigital font formats kept the limitation to one ‘surface’ per glyph. Using overprinting the impression of three colors can be achieved with just two colors. This has been done beautifully and pictures of some magnificent examples are available online. More than one color per letter required separate fonts for the differently colored parts and a new print run for every color. When printing with wood or lead type the limitation to one color per glyph is inherent (if you don’t count random gradients). Like it happened with many other techniques before, it took some time for digital type to overcome the constraints of the old technique. Getting a polychrome letter required multiplying the content for every color. Is it better to freeze strawberries whole or sliced? ![]() Repeat this process for any more berries you plan to freeze. ![]() Remove the strawberries from the parchment and transfer them to resealable freezer bags and immediately return to the freezer. Place the baking sheet in the freezer and freeze until the berries are fully hardened, about three hours. Place the sliced berries on a parchment-lined baking sheet in a single layer (make sure none of them are touching). (This is up to you depending on how you plan to use the berries later.) They'll be difficult to slice once they're frozen, so only freeze them whole if you plan to use them whole (like if you're adding them to smoothies or something similar). You can slice them in half, quarter them, or thickly slice them. Thoroughly wash and dry your strawberries, then hull them by inserting a paring knife into the stem end and cutting in a small circle to carefully remove the leafy greens. Crypto currency compare1/30/2024 What is the difference between virtual currency, digital currency, cryptocurrency, and Bitcoin?ĭigital currency refers to any currency that exists online. Virtual currency is a digital representation of value and subset of digital currency. Cryptocurrency investors can buy or sell them directly in a spot market, or they can invest indirectly in a futures market or by using investment products that provide cryptocurrency exposure. How does cryptocurrency get its value?Ĭryptocurrency's value stems from a combination of scarcity and the perception that it is a store of value, an anonymous means of payment, or a hedge against inflation. The Ethereum blockchain allows users to create programmable "smart contracts" which execute only after certain conditions are met between two or more parties. Ether (ETH)Įther is a cryptocurrency that is native to the Ethereum blockchain and network. Popular Types of Cryptocurrencies Bitcoinīitcoin, the most well-known cryptocurrency, allows for direct peer-to-peer exchange of value on a decentralized payment network.
